AI-guided exploration of viral shells
Our MitoVir lab at the University of Groningen has received an NWO Open Competition Domain Science XS grant for the project “AI-guided exploration of viral capsid interfaces as antiviral targets.” [Link]
Viruses are tiny infectious particles that protect their genetic material inside a shell, similar to how an egg protects what is inside. This shell is essential for the virus to enter cells and spread. Many antivirals work by blocking virus multiplication in cells, but these can lose effectiveness and may cause side effects.
In this one‑year project, we explore a different idea: targeting the virus’ shell itself. Using artificial intelligence, we will search for weak spots in this shell in human adenovirus and design molecules that disrupt it. This research aims to open new routes toward medicines that prevent viral infections.
